亚洲成年人黄色一级片,日本香港三级亚洲三级,黄色成人小视频,国产青草视频,国产一区二区久久精品,91在线免费公开视频,成年轻人网站色直接看

標簽轉(zhuǎn)換裝置的制造方法

文檔序號:9923530閱讀:349來源:國知局
標簽轉(zhuǎn)換裝置的制造方法
【技術(shù)領(lǐng)域】
[0001 ]本發(fā)明涉及一種標簽轉(zhuǎn)換裝置。
【背景技術(shù)】
[0002]在數(shù)據(jù)中心等的網(wǎng)絡構(gòu)建中,作為虛擬地按每個顧客分離網(wǎng)絡的方式,一直以來使用IEEE802.1Q(VLAN標簽方式)。但是,近年來,隨著數(shù)據(jù)中心的需求增加,要求的網(wǎng)絡可分離數(shù)也增加,若是基于VLAN標簽方式的可分離數(shù)4094個則不足,這成為課題。
[0003]因此,在IEEE802.1ad中,標準化了雙層VLAN標簽方式。雙層VLAN標簽方式采用使用兩個VLAN標簽的雙層標簽結(jié)構(gòu)。一個VLAN標簽被稱為C-tag(Customer tag:客戶標簽),另一個VLAN標簽被稱為S_tag(Service tag:服務標簽)。
[0004]例如,C-tag用于由數(shù)據(jù)中心運營者分離網(wǎng)絡,S-tag用于由將多個數(shù)據(jù)中心連接的通信運營者分離數(shù)據(jù)中心運營者。通過雙層VLAN標簽方式,數(shù)據(jù)中心運營者能夠分離數(shù)據(jù)中心的網(wǎng)絡,同時,通信運營者能夠分離多個數(shù)據(jù)中心運營者。雙層VLAN標簽方式在整體上能夠分離出4094個X 4094個=約16萬個網(wǎng)絡。
[0005]并且,提出了VXLAN(VirtualeExtensible Local Area Network:虛擬可擴展局域網(wǎng))標簽方式。VXLAN標簽方式通過利用VXLAN標簽將顧客幀封裝化來增加網(wǎng)絡分離的上限數(shù)量。
[0006]VXLAN標簽主要由UDP/IP頭和能夠分離為約16萬個的網(wǎng)絡分離標識符(24比特)構(gòu)成。與IEEE802.1ad相比,VXLAN標簽方式可以稱為單層標簽結(jié)構(gòu)。利用VXLAN標簽被封裝化的顧客幀可以還包括VLAN標簽。該幀的結(jié)構(gòu)可以說是基于VXLAN標簽和VLAN標簽的雙層標簽結(jié)構(gòu)。
[0007]除此以外,專利文獻I公開了以下網(wǎng)絡結(jié)構(gòu)(參照摘要)。虛擬網(wǎng)絡在物理裝置上具有虛擬機,虛擬機連接于網(wǎng)絡接口。網(wǎng)絡接口經(jīng)由傳輸網(wǎng)絡而通過隧道相互連接。各網(wǎng)絡接口具有傳輸網(wǎng)絡的地址空間中的傳輸?shù)刂?。各網(wǎng)絡接口具有能夠重構(gòu)的地址映射,決定用于包的傳輸?shù)刂?,用該傳輸?shù)刂穼庋b化。
[0008]專利文獻1:美國專利第8223770號
[0009]在數(shù)據(jù)中心內(nèi),運用著各種設(shè)備。因此,存在VLAN標簽方式、VXLAN標簽方式、以及VXLAN標簽方式與VLAN標簽方式的組合等應用于通信裝置的網(wǎng)絡分離方式不同的情況。但是,上述現(xiàn)有技術(shù)無法進行單層標簽方式與雙層標簽方式之間、不同的單層標簽方式之間等不同的標簽方式之間的通信。因此,難以進行靈活的網(wǎng)絡構(gòu)建。

【發(fā)明內(nèi)容】

[0010]本發(fā)明的代表性的一例的標簽轉(zhuǎn)換裝置,包括:能夠進行網(wǎng)絡通信的多個端口;和控制器,所述控制器保存將通信裝置的地址與用于進行網(wǎng)絡分離的標簽方式中的標簽的信息建立關(guān)聯(lián)的標簽轉(zhuǎn)換信息,所述控制器對輸入到所述多個端口中的一個端口的幀進行分析,來決定用于進行所述幀的網(wǎng)絡分離的當前標簽方式,所述控制器基于所述標簽轉(zhuǎn)換信息,決定與所述幀的目的地地址建立了關(guān)聯(lián)的標簽方式,所述控制器在與所述目的地地址建立了關(guān)聯(lián)的標簽方式不同于所述當前標簽方式的情況下,基于所述標簽轉(zhuǎn)換信息,將所述幀轉(zhuǎn)換為與所述目的地地址建立了關(guān)聯(lián)的標簽方式的幀,所述控制器從所述多個端口中的一個端口輸出所述轉(zhuǎn)換得到的幀。
[0011]發(fā)明效果
[0012]根據(jù)本發(fā)明的一個方式,能夠進行靈活的網(wǎng)絡的構(gòu)建。
【附圖說明】
[0013]圖1示意性地表示實施例1中的、包括網(wǎng)絡系統(tǒng)和管理該網(wǎng)絡系統(tǒng)的管理裝置的系統(tǒng)的結(jié)構(gòu)例。
[0014]圖2示意性地表示管理裝置的硬件結(jié)構(gòu)例。
[0015]圖3表示在網(wǎng)絡系統(tǒng)100內(nèi)傳輸?shù)膸臉?gòu)造例。
[0016]圖4表示將圖1所示的多個虛擬機匯總而形成的網(wǎng)分組的例子。
[0017]圖5表示對網(wǎng)分組和虛擬機配備的信息進行管理的顧客管理表的結(jié)構(gòu)例。
[0018]圖6A表示網(wǎng)域A的網(wǎng)±或六管理表的結(jié)構(gòu)例。
[0019]圖6B表示網(wǎng)域B的網(wǎng)域B管理表的結(jié)構(gòu)例。
[0020 ]圖6C表示網(wǎng)域C的網(wǎng)域C管理表的結(jié)構(gòu)例。
[0021]圖7表示管理裝置創(chuàng)建網(wǎng)域A管理表、網(wǎng)域B管理表、網(wǎng)域C管理表以及標簽轉(zhuǎn)換表的流程圖。
[0022]圖8表不標簽轉(zhuǎn)換表的結(jié)構(gòu)例。
[0023]圖9A表示標簽轉(zhuǎn)換裝置的邏輯結(jié)構(gòu)例。
[0024I圖9B表示標簽轉(zhuǎn)換裝置的硬件結(jié)構(gòu)例。
[0025]圖10表示在各網(wǎng)域的管理表被更新的情況下更新標簽轉(zhuǎn)換表的流程圖。
[0026]圖11示意性地表示實施例2中的、包括網(wǎng)絡系統(tǒng)和管理該網(wǎng)絡系統(tǒng)的管理裝置的系統(tǒng)的結(jié)構(gòu)例。
[0027]圖12表示將圖11所示的多個虛擬機匯總而形成的網(wǎng)分組的例子。
[0028]圖13表示實施例2的顧客管理表的結(jié)構(gòu)例。
[0029]圖14A表示網(wǎng)域Al的網(wǎng)域Al管理表的結(jié)構(gòu)例。
[0030]圖14B表示網(wǎng)域BI的網(wǎng)域BI管理表的結(jié)構(gòu)例。
[0031]圖14C表示網(wǎng)域A2的網(wǎng)域A2管理表的結(jié)構(gòu)例。
[0032]圖14D表示網(wǎng)域B2的網(wǎng)域B2管理表的結(jié)構(gòu)例。
[0033]圖15表示在實施例2中追加的網(wǎng)域連接關(guān)系表的結(jié)構(gòu)例。
[0034]圖16表示實施例2中的標簽轉(zhuǎn)換表的結(jié)構(gòu)例。
[0035]附圖標記說明
[0036]1、1A、1B:標簽轉(zhuǎn)換裝置
[0037]11:路徑?jīng)Q定部
[0038]12:幀操作部
[0039]14: PORT(標簽方式 A)
[0040]15: PORT (標簽方式 B)[0041 ]16: PORT(標簽方式A+標簽方式B)
[0042]2:管理裝置
[0043]21:系統(tǒng)管理部
[0044]22:顧客信息管理部
[0045]23:網(wǎng)域A控制部
[0046]24:網(wǎng)域B控制部
[0047]25:網(wǎng)域C控制部
[0048]26:標簽轉(zhuǎn)換裝置控制部
[0049]27:表存儲部
[0050]3A:網(wǎng)域A
[0051]3B:網(wǎng)域B
[0052]3C:網(wǎng)域C
[0053]40:顧客管理表
[0054]50:網(wǎng)域A管理表
[0055]52:網(wǎng)域B管理表
[0056]54:網(wǎng)域C管理表
[0057]80:標簽轉(zhuǎn)換表
[0058]131:網(wǎng)域Al管理表
[0059]132:網(wǎng)域A2管理表
[0060]133:網(wǎng)域BI管理表[0061 ]134:網(wǎng)域B2管理表
【具體實施方式】
[0062]下面,參照附圖來說明本發(fā)明的實施方式。應注意本實施方式只不過是用于實現(xiàn)本發(fā)明的一例,并不限定本發(fā)明的技術(shù)范圍。在各圖中對共同的結(jié)構(gòu)附加有相同的參照符號。
[0063 ]本實施方式表示采用不同的虛擬網(wǎng)絡分離方式的網(wǎng)絡間的幀傳輸技術(shù)。虛擬網(wǎng)絡分離方式通過對幀賦予不同的標識符的標簽來虛擬地分離網(wǎng)絡。作為利用標簽的網(wǎng)絡分離方式的例子,已知VLAN標簽方式、雙層VLAN標簽方式、VXLAN標簽方式等。
[0064]例如,在數(shù)據(jù)中心內(nèi)運用著各種設(shè)備,有時每個設(shè)備所能夠處理的網(wǎng)絡分離方式不同。在無法在網(wǎng)絡分離方式不同的通信裝置間進行通信的情況下,難以進行靈活的網(wǎng)絡構(gòu)建。另外,在針對被分離的各個網(wǎng)絡設(shè)置用于測量通信量、廢棄量的計數(shù)器來進行帶寬限制的結(jié)構(gòu)中,需要準備與被分離的網(wǎng)絡數(shù)量相應的大量的資源。
[0065]本實施方式提供一種對接收到的幀的標簽方式進行識別并能夠?qū)⒆R別出的標簽方式的幀構(gòu)造轉(zhuǎn)換為其它標簽方式的標簽轉(zhuǎn)換裝置。標簽轉(zhuǎn)換裝置保存將通信裝置的地址與特定標簽方式的標簽標識符相關(guān)聯(lián)的標簽轉(zhuǎn)換信息。標簽轉(zhuǎn)換裝置參照標簽轉(zhuǎn)換信息,來將接收到的幀轉(zhuǎn)換為與幀的目的地地址相應的標簽方式的幀構(gòu)造。通過使用標簽轉(zhuǎn)換表在不同的標簽方式間轉(zhuǎn)換幀構(gòu)造,能夠創(chuàng)建包括不同的標簽方式的通信裝置的靈活的網(wǎng)絡分組。
[0066]另外,標簽轉(zhuǎn)換裝置進行單層標簽方式的通信裝置與多層標簽方式的通信裝置之間的標簽方式轉(zhuǎn)換。標簽轉(zhuǎn)換裝置將不同的標簽標識符的單層標簽方式的幀轉(zhuǎn)換為具有共同的標簽標識符的多層標簽方式的幀。通過利用共同的標簽標識符進行幀的統(tǒng)計信息收集、帶寬控制,能夠降低它們所需的資源。
[0067][實施例1]
[0068]說明數(shù)據(jù)中心內(nèi)的網(wǎng)絡和服務器的運用管理的實施例。本實施例將多個通信裝置匯總而構(gòu)成分組,進行使得只能在所構(gòu)成的分組內(nèi)進行通信的虛擬網(wǎng)絡分離。將能夠相互通信的通信裝置的分組稱為網(wǎng)絡分組。
[0069]網(wǎng)分組包括多個通信裝置,通信裝置分別是虛擬通信裝置或物理通信裝置。在物理服務器內(nèi)能夠構(gòu)建虛擬機(VM)。在以下說明的例子中,網(wǎng)分組由多個虛擬機構(gòu)成。對網(wǎng)分組內(nèi)的虛擬機有可能應用不同的標簽方式。數(shù)據(jù)中心運營者向數(shù)據(jù)中心利用者(還稱為顧客)借出虛擬機和網(wǎng)絡。
[0070]圖1示意性地表示本實施例中的、包括網(wǎng)絡系統(tǒng)100和管理該網(wǎng)絡系統(tǒng)100的管理裝置2的系統(tǒng)的結(jié)構(gòu)例。網(wǎng)絡系統(tǒng)100包括標簽轉(zhuǎn)換裝置1、網(wǎng)域(Domain)A(3A)、網(wǎng)域B(3B)以及網(wǎng)域C(3C)。網(wǎng)域包括I個以上的通信裝置,對全部通信裝置應用共同的標簽轉(zhuǎn)換方式。通信裝置分別是物理通信裝置或虛擬通信裝置。
[0071]標簽轉(zhuǎn)換裝置I是連接于網(wǎng)域A(3A)、網(wǎng)域B(3B)以及網(wǎng)域C(3C)而在網(wǎng)域間傳輸幀的交換機。在圖1的例子中,標簽轉(zhuǎn)換裝置I與網(wǎng)域A(3A)經(jīng)由端口 IlA和端口31A而發(fā)送接收幀。標簽轉(zhuǎn)換裝置I與網(wǎng)域B(3B)經(jīng)由端口 IIB和端口 3IB而發(fā)送接收幀。標簽轉(zhuǎn)換裝置I與網(wǎng)域C(3C)經(jīng)由端口 11C和端口 31C而發(fā)送接收幀。
[0072]網(wǎng)域A(3A)在網(wǎng)絡分離方式中使用標簽方式A來進行通信。網(wǎng)域B(3B)在網(wǎng)絡分離方式中使用標簽方式B來進行通信。網(wǎng)域C(3C)在網(wǎng)絡分離方式中使用標簽方式A+標簽方式B來進行通信。
[0073]標簽轉(zhuǎn)換裝置I進行幀的標簽轉(zhuǎn)換,使得能夠在標簽方式A、標簽方式B以及標簽方式A+標簽方式B之間進行通信。對于網(wǎng)域所使用的標簽方式不特別限定。例如,標簽方式A既可以是VXLAN標簽方式,也可以是NVGRE(Network Virtualizat1n using GenericRouting Encapsulat1n)。在以下說明的例子中,設(shè)標簽方式A是VXLAN標簽方式,標簽方式B是VLAN標簽方式。
[0074]網(wǎng)域A(3A)?網(wǎng)域C(3C)分別包括經(jīng)由網(wǎng)絡進行通信的I個以上的物理通信裝置。物理通信裝置例如是物理服務器或存儲數(shù)據(jù)的物理存儲裝置。網(wǎng)域可以包括將多個物理通信裝置相互連接的交換機。
[0075]網(wǎng)域A(3A)?網(wǎng)域C(3C)分別包括能夠連接于外部網(wǎng)絡的端口31A?端口 31C。例如,網(wǎng)域A( 3A)?網(wǎng)域C( 3C)分別也可以是包括端口 31A?端口 31C的一個物理服務器。
[0076]在圖1的例子中,網(wǎng)域A(3A)在內(nèi)部構(gòu)成多個虛擬機Al(1Al)?虛擬機A5(10A5)。虛擬機Al (10A1)?虛擬機A5( 10A5)通過標簽方式A進行網(wǎng)絡分離來進行通信。在本例中,標簽方式A是VXLAN標簽方式。
[0077]對虛擬機Al (10A1)和虛擬機A2(10A2)分配有相同的VXLAN標識符(VNII)。在圖1中,以VNI表示VXLAN標識符。VNI表示Virtual Network Identif ier (虛擬網(wǎng)絡標識符)。對它們的幀賦予VXLAN標識符I (VNI1)的VXLAN標簽。對虛擬機A3(10A3)?虛擬機A5(10A5)分別分配有VXLAN標識符2(VNI2)?VXLAN標識符4(VNI4)。
[0078] 網(wǎng)域B(3B)在內(nèi)部構(gòu)成多個虛擬機BI (10B1)?虛擬機B5(10B5)。虛擬機BI (10B1)?虛擬機B5(10B5)通過標簽方式B進行網(wǎng)絡分離來進行通信。在本例中,標簽方式B是VLAN標簽方式。
[0079 ] 對虛擬機B I(1Bl)分配有VLAN標識符1 (VLANlO)。對虛擬機B2 (10B2)和虛擬機B3(10B3)分配有相同的VLAN標識符20(VLAN20)。對虛擬機B4(10B4)和虛擬機B5(10B5)分別分配有VLAN標識符30 (VLAN30)和VLAN標識符40 (VLAN40)。
[0080] 網(wǎng)域C(3C)在內(nèi)部構(gòu)成多個虛擬機Cl (10C1)?虛擬機C5(10C5)。虛擬機Cl (
當前第1頁1 2 3 4 5 
網(wǎng)友詢問留言 已有0條留言
  • 還沒有人留言評論。精彩留言會獲得點贊!
1